import type { Client, Options as Options2, TDataShape } from './client/index.js'; import type { AddLinkPermissionData, AddLinkPermissionErrors, AddLinkPermissionResponses, AddTagsBulkData, AddTagsBulkResponses, ArchiveLinkData, ArchiveLinkErrors, ArchiveLinkResponses, ArchiveLinksBulkData, ArchiveLinksBulkErrors, ArchiveLinksBulkResponses, CreateDomainData, CreateDomainErrors, CreateDomainResponses, CreateExampleLinksData, CreateExampleLinksErrors, CreateExampleLinksResponses, CreateFolderData, CreateFolderResponses, CreateLinkCountriesBulkData, CreateLinkCountriesBulkResponses, CreateLinkCountryData, CreateLinkCountryResponses, CreateLinkData, CreateLinkErrors, CreateLinkPublicData, CreateLinkPublicErrors, CreateLinkPublicResponses, CreateLinkRegionData, CreateLinkRegionResponses, CreateLinkRegionsBulkData, CreateLinkRegionsBulkResponses, CreateLinkResponses, CreateLinksBulkData, CreateLinksBulkResponses, CreateLinkSimpleData, CreateLinkSimpleResponses, DeleteLinkCountryData, DeleteLinkCountryResponses, DeleteLinkData, DeleteLinkErrors, DeleteLinkPermissionData, DeleteLinkPermissionErrors, DeleteLinkPermissionResponses, DeleteLinkRegionData, DeleteLinkRegionResponses, DeleteLinkResponses, DeleteLinksBulkData, DeleteLinksBulkResponses, DuplicateLinkData, DuplicateLinkErrors, DuplicateLinkResponses, ExpandLinkData, ExpandLinkErrors, ExpandLinkResponses, GenerateQrCodeData, GenerateQrCodeResponses, GenerateQrCodesBulkData, GenerateQrCodesBulkResponses, GetDomainData, GetDomainErrors, GetDomainResponses, GetFolderData, GetFolderResponses, GetLinkByOriginalUrlData, GetLinkByOriginalUrlResponses, GetLinkCountriesData, GetLinkCountriesResponses, GetLinkData, GetLinkErrors, GetLinkOpengraphData, GetLinkOpengraphResponses, GetLinkPermissionsData, GetLinkPermissionsErrors, GetLinkPermissionsResponses, GetLinkRegionsData, GetLinkRegionsResponses, GetLinkResponses, GetLinksByUrlData, GetLinksByUrlResponses, GetRegionsByCountryData, GetRegionsByCountryResponses, ListDomainsData, ListDomainsResponses, ListFoldersData, ListFoldersResponses, ListLinksData, ListLinksErrors, ListLinksResponses, UnarchiveLinkData, UnarchiveLinkErrors, UnarchiveLinkResponses, UnarchiveLinksBulkData, UnarchiveLinksBulkErrors, UnarchiveLinksBulkResponses, UpdateDomainSettingsData, UpdateDomainSettingsErrors, UpdateDomainSettingsResponses, UpdateLinkData, UpdateLinkErrors, UpdateLinkOpengraphData, UpdateLinkOpengraphResponses, UpdateLinkResponses } from './types.gen.js'; export type Options = Options2 & { client?: Client; meta?: Record; }; export declare const getLinkOpengraph: (options: Options) => import("./client/index.js").RequestResult; export declare const updateLinkOpengraph: (options: Options) => import("./client/index.js").RequestResult; export declare const getLinkCountries: (options: Options) => import("./client/index.js").RequestResult; export declare const createLinkCountry: (options: Options) => import("./client/index.js").RequestResult; export declare const createLinkCountriesBulk: (options: Options) => import("./client/index.js").RequestResult; export declare const deleteLinkCountry: (options: Options) => import("./client/index.js").RequestResult; export declare const getLinkRegions: (options: Options) => import("./client/index.js").RequestResult; export declare const createLinkRegion: (options: Options) => import("./client/index.js").RequestResult; export declare const getRegionsByCountry: (options: Options) => import("./client/index.js").RequestResult; export declare const createLinkRegionsBulk: (options: Options) => import("./client/index.js").RequestResult; export declare const deleteLinkRegion: (options: Options) => import("./client/index.js").RequestResult; export declare const getLinkPermissions: (options: Options) => import("./client/index.js").RequestResult; export declare const deleteLinkPermission: (options: Options) => import("./client/index.js").RequestResult; export declare const addLinkPermission: (options: Options) => import("./client/index.js").RequestResult; export declare const listLinks: (options: Options) => import("./client/index.js").RequestResult; export declare const generateQrCode: (options: Options) => import("./client/index.js").RequestResult; export declare const generateQrCodesBulk: (options: Options) => import("./client/index.js").RequestResult; export declare const deleteLink: (options: Options) => import("./client/index.js").RequestResult; export declare const deleteLinksBulk: (options: Options) => import("./client/index.js").RequestResult; export declare const archiveLink: (options: Options) => import("./client/index.js").RequestResult; export declare const archiveLinksBulk: (options: Options) => import("./client/index.js").RequestResult; export declare const unarchiveLink: (options: Options) => import("./client/index.js").RequestResult; export declare const unarchiveLinksBulk: (options: Options) => import("./client/index.js").RequestResult; export declare const getLink: (options: Options) => import("./client/index.js").RequestResult; export declare const updateLink: (options: Options) => import("./client/index.js").RequestResult; export declare const expandLink: (options: Options) => import("./client/index.js").RequestResult; export declare const getLinkByOriginalUrl: (options: Options) => import("./client/index.js").RequestResult; export declare const getLinksByUrl: (options: Options) => import("./client/index.js").RequestResult; export declare const createLink: (options?: Options) => import("./client/index.js").RequestResult; export declare const createLinkSimple: (options: Options) => import("./client/index.js").RequestResult; export declare const createLinkPublic: (options: Options) => import("./client/index.js").RequestResult; export declare const createLinksBulk: (options: Options) => import("./client/index.js").RequestResult; export declare const createExampleLinks: (options: Options) => import("./client/index.js").RequestResult; export declare const duplicateLink: (options: Options) => import("./client/index.js").RequestResult; export declare const listDomains: (options?: Options) => import("./client/index.js").RequestResult; export declare const getDomain: (options: Options) => import("./client/index.js").RequestResult; export declare const updateDomainSettings: (options: Options) => import("./client/index.js").RequestResult; export declare const addTagsBulk: (options: Options) => import("./client/index.js").RequestResult; export declare const createDomain: (options: Options) => import("./client/index.js").RequestResult; export declare const listFolders: (options: Options) => import("./client/index.js").RequestResult; export declare const getFolder: (options: Options) => import("./client/index.js").RequestResult; export declare const createFolder: (options: Options) => import("./client/index.js").RequestResult;